Fume Extraction Gun for Large Weldments, Confined Spaces

The 300 amp Clean Air Fume Extraction MIG gun from Bernard reduces smoke at the source with a small vacuum chamber that provides good joint access and visibility, along with a 360 deg vacuum hose swivel on the rear of the handle for improved flexibility that reduces operator wrist fatigue.

Better Fume Control for Large Weldments Starts at the Source

Is your weld fume solution a fan and an open window? Working on large weldments – such as heavy equipment, ships or wind turbines – makes fume capture a challenge. However, today’s manufacturers have more options for fume control than ever. The best option for manual welding of large components may be one you haven’t considered for a while: the fume gun.
